【技术实现步骤摘要】
存储器、蓝牙智能终端、距离计算方法及开门控制方法
本专利技术涉及智慧社区领域,尤其涉及一种存储器、蓝牙智能终端、距离计算方法及开门控制方法。
技术介绍
随着现代人们生活水平的提高和社区的发展,人们对居住条件提出了越来越高的需求,社区的安全防范也越来越受到人们的关注。随着数字化技术和网络技术的飞速发展,门禁技术也得到了迅猛发展,它早已超越了单纯的门道及钥匙管理,逐渐发展成为一套完整的出入管理系统,成为解决重要部门出入口实现安全防范管理的有效措施。由于蓝牙传输可实现信号的短距离读取,因此门禁管理系统越来越多地使用蓝牙来进行自动授权开门。目前,蓝牙门禁管理系统都是在蓝牙智能终端的APP层进行开发,而且,蓝牙门禁设备的大门通常有延时自动开门的功能,所以,蓝牙智能终端需要在用户离大门一定距离(例如1.5米)时控制开门。例如,具体的开门流程为:用户进入蓝牙门禁设备的广播范围内时,当蓝牙智能终端判断出用户具有开门权限,且其离蓝牙门禁设备的距离值达到预设距离值时,向蓝牙门禁设备发送开门命令,这样,就可使用户在走到门口处时,大门刚好打开。目前,蓝牙智能终端在计算其离蓝牙门禁设备的距 ...
【技术保护点】
一种蓝牙智能终端与蓝牙门禁设备的距离计算方法,其特征在于,包括以下步骤:S10.蓝牙智能终端实时获取来自蓝牙门禁设备的接收信号的信号强度值;S20.开一滑动窗口,并获取所述滑动窗口内最新的第一数量个信号强度值,所述第一数量小于与蓝牙智能终端的硬件性能相关的第二数量;S30.根据预先建立的正态分布模型获取每个信号强度值所对应的权重值,并根据每个信号强度值所对应的权重值,计算所述第一数量个信号强度值的加权平均值;S40.根据所述加权平均值计算蓝牙智能终端与蓝牙门禁设备的距离值。
【技术特征摘要】
1.一种蓝牙智能终端与蓝牙门禁设备的距离计算方法,其特征在于,包括以下步骤:S10.蓝牙智能终端实时获取来自蓝牙门禁设备的接收信号的信号强度值;S20.开一滑动窗口,并获取所述滑动窗口内最新的第一数量个信号强度值,所述第一数量小于与蓝牙智能终端的硬件性能相关的第二数量;S30.根据预先建立的正态分布模型获取每个信号强度值所对应的权重值,并根据每个信号强度值所对应的权重值,计算所述第一数量个信号强度值的加权平均值;S40.根据所述加权平均值计算蓝牙智能终端与蓝牙门禁设备的距离值。2.根据权利要求1所述的蓝牙智能终端与蓝牙门禁设备的距离计算方法,其特征在于,在所述步骤S30中,根据预先建立的正态分布模型获取每个信号强度值所对应的权重值的步骤包括:S31.将所述滑动窗口内最新的第一数量个信号强度值按大小顺序依次进行排序;S32.为每个信号强度值分配权重值,其中,所分配的权重值与所述信号强度值的排列序号相关。3.根据权利要求2所述的蓝牙智能终端与蓝牙门禁设备的距离计算方法,其特征在于,在所述步骤S32中,针对排序后的每个信号强度值,均进行以下步骤:S321.计算当前的信号强度值分别与排序后的所有信号强度值的差值绝对值;S322.判断所计算的每个差值绝对值分别所在的区间范围;S323.获取每个区间范围内的差值绝对值的数量,并分别计算每个区间范围内的差值绝对值的数量与所述第一数量的比值;S324.根据所计算的比值,为当前的信号强度值分配权重值。4.根据权利要求1所述的蓝牙智能终端与蓝牙门禁设备的距离计算方法,其特征在于,所述步骤S40包括:S41.根据以下公式计算蓝牙智能终端与蓝牙门禁设备的距离值,ratio<1时,d=ratio10,ratio≥1时,d=A*ratioB+C,其中,rssi为第一数量个信号强度值的加权平均值,twpower为标定值,所述标定值为在特定位置处测量得到的信号强度值,ratio为比值,A、B、C为拟合系数,d为距离值。5.根据权利要求1所述的蓝牙智能终端与蓝牙门禁设备的距离计算方法,其特征在于,所述步骤S40包括:S42.根据所述加权平均值确定蓝牙智能终端当...
【专利技术属性】
技术研发人员:宋政斌,仝海燕,
申请(专利权)人:北京千丁互联科技有限公司,
类型:发明
国别省市:广东,44
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。